Add a picture to a command button on a data access page
Open a data access page in Design view.
Click the command button you want to add the picture to, and then click Properties on the
toolbar.
Click the Format tab, and in the BackgroundImage property box, specify the location of image you want to use in the following format:
url("http://WebServerName/FileName")
Do one of the following:
To specify that only one image appears on the button, set the BackgroundRepeat property to no-repeat.
To specify that copies of the image appear in a horizontal line on the button, set the BackgroundRepeat property to repeat-x.
To specify that copies of the image appear in a vertical line on the button, set the BackgroundRepeat property to repeat-y.
Set the position of the image in the BackgroundPositionX and BackgroundPostionY property boxes.
